How to Choose the Shoes According to Your Lifestyle

Your feet are both literally and figuratively the foundation of your body and good health. Generally, after you kept your stems hidden in heavy shoes all winter, summer should be seen as an opportunity to let them relax and breathe.

Regardless of the season, in order to maintain the good health of your feet, you should pay great attention to the shoes you choose. What you wear ought to be adjusted to your personal/professional requirements and your health needs, thus maintaining a good balance between comfort and fashion. Selecting an adequate pair of footwear is mandatory if you want to prevent health problems, but most people only pay attention to aesthetics when they go shopping. According to a research originally published in Hello Magazine, 60% of women suffer from foot pain due to high heels, which leads to problems with feet, ankles and back. It is commonly forgotten that every muscle and bone in your body is interlinked to one another; so ignoring one can bring the entire body down.
